原创 Ubuntu18 安裝NoMachine遠程桌面(解決遠程桌面延遲)

# 問題:Ubuntu 18 使用自帶的共享桌面、VNC遠程桌面延遲、降低分辨率也無效。 # 方案:最後找到安裝 NoMachine的遠程桌面,解決遠程卡頓問題 根據自己操作系統 選擇NoMachine for Linux進行下載官網:ht

原创 DNS查詢解析域名信息後出現本機地址127.0.0.1和0.0.0.0

一、現象背景: 接某地區分公司同事反饋,手機移動網絡無法通過公網訪問公司業務系統 二、分析過程:1、查看流量入口Nginx,公網訪問記錄都正常,無異常日誌。 2、聯繫用戶查詢手機客戶端出口IP,通過瀏覽器地址欄中輸入,在外部防火牆側和Ng

原创 logstash數據無法寫入到es

現象:偶發性某天應用服務日誌數據丟失,查看es無數據 架構:filebeat--->logstash--->es logstash 上報錯現象: 2023-10-13T13:05:14,161][WARN ][logstash.outpu

原创 flask_paginate對mysql數據進行分頁查詢

  使用flask_paginate對mysql數據進行分頁查詢,這裏介紹使用原生sql方法,也可以使用SQLAlchemy對數據做查詢 app.py from flask import Flask,render_template,red

原创 python虛擬環境創建及使用

 爲不同的應用將可以使用不同的py虛擬環境,解決在相同服務器上相沖突。 Virtualenv模塊: Python虛擬環境管理工具,python2-python3.4推薦使用Venv模塊:Python標準庫內置的虛擬環境管理工具,python

原创 應用容器接入istio的sidecar啓動出現無法訪問網絡

故障現象:該問題的表現是接入了sidecar proxy的應用在啓動過程中發現一小段時間內,無法通過網絡訪問 pod 外部的其他服務,例如外部的 Erueke,MySQL等服務,通過服務的重試功能過段時間應用又正常啓動了。日誌:ERROR[

原创 CentOS 6的yum源配置(最新地址)

CentOS 6 操作系統版本結束了生命週期(EOL),Linux社區已不再維護該操作系統版本。建議您升級操作系統至CentOS 7及以上,如果您的業務過渡期仍需要使用CentOS 6系統中的一些安裝包,請根據下文切換CentOS 6的源。

原创 解決docker設置HTTP/HTTPS代理TLS handshake timeout

背景:由於本地內網服務器的internet是受限制的(需要配置遠程代理上網,不能直接上網)。因此,在使用docker連接docker hub的時候,就會出錯。 docker pull nginx(拉取dockerhub鏡像) 問題一:Err

原创 解決前端部署到Nginx非根目錄下頁面出現空白的問題

問題:      最近前端vue項目遷移至K8S容器中,因在Nginx非根目錄下頁面下出現空白的問題 現象:    前端系統頁面空白,只有標題欄 nginx容器默認配置: location / {     root /usr/s

原创 解決docker中Easyexcel因缺少字體無法導出的問題

問題:        最近因公司業務由傳統虛擬機方式遷移至容器docker方式部署後,最近發現某處導出excel報表後無內容(0字節) 報錯:Error: java.lang.reflect.InvocationTargetExceptio

原创 Consul踢除失效服務和移除Node節點

在Consul日常維護中,由於Consul不會自動將不可用的服務實例註銷掉和移除node節點.在實際使用過程中,可能因爲一些操作失誤、環境變更等原因讓Consul中存在一些無效實例信息,而這些實例在Consul中會長期存在,並處於斷開狀態。

原创 python-day4-字符串,列表相關方法

# ### 字符串的相關方法# *capitalize 字符串首字母大寫 strvar = "i am a boy"# strvar = "我是一個男孩ooo" # 對於中文特殊字符無效res = strvar.capitalize()pr

原创 Mongodb連接認證errmsg: "auth failed"解決方法

連接方式:mongo --host xxxx --port 27017 -u xxx -p xxx 報錯: connected to: 192.168.xx.xx:27017assertion: 18 { ok: 0.0, errmsg:

原创 python-day3-條件判斷與循環

# ### 代碼塊 : 用冒號作爲開始,用縮進來劃分相同的作用域 """作用域: 作用範圍""" # 基本使用 """代碼塊是一個整體,在條件滿足時,會一併執行,否則一併不執行""" if 10 == 10: print(1)

原创 python-day2-運算符

# ### 變量的緩存機制 (僅對python3.6版本負責)# -->Number 部分(int,float.bool,complex)# 1.對於整數而言,-5~正無窮範圍內的相同值,id一致var1 = 10var2 = 10var1